We all have so much going on in our lives - competing strains and stresses – not to mention the recent pandemic and current #offairnightmare . 

This has meant at times we may have pushed kindness to one side, in favour of what is urgent now.

It can also be easy to show kindness when posting online, but when it comes to reality it's harder to commit in the same way to our real-life words and actions.

Why should we bother being kind to everyone when it's not always mutual?

By taking the time to be kind to others, we can benefit from emotional upsides. It really does make a difference, especially for people who are vulnerable or struggling.

Kindness also leads to:

■ better self esteem
■ the knowledge you may have made a difference to someone's day
■ a better outcome, usually
■ develops empathy which is a vital skill
■ a more positive working environment
■ reduced stress
■ provides the power to right a wrong
■ enables us to find solutions
■ creates opportunity for others which may lead to opportunity for all

A few simple words may be all it takes to turnaround someone else's bad day

Holding a door open for the person behind you that delays you a fraction might give them the confidence boost or feeling of being valued they desperately need

Letting the person with 1 item in the queue behind you get home a few minutes earlier might give them a moment to breathe

Sharing your lunch with a colleague who didn't have time to go and get any might open conversation that leads to great ideas

Doing any small thing with kindness costs nothing and will have little impact on your day but if we then start to receive such kindness too, wouldn't life feel a little less shitty?!
